For smallholder farmers and agricultural enterprises across developing economies, access to formal financial services has historically been constrained by fragmented land records, irregular cash flows, and high perceived credit risk. Traditional banks often lack the infrastructure to underwrite agricultural borrowers cost-effectively, leaving an estimated 1.7 billion unbanked individuals reliant on informal lending channels with prohibitive interest rates. Agri-Fintech Platforms are now redefining this paradigm by embedding financial services directly into agricultural value chains. These platforms leverage digital lending infrastructure, alternative credit scoring models powered by satellite imagery and transaction data, and agricultural insurance mechanisms to address the sector’s unique risk profile. As the global market accelerates toward a projected US$4.32 billion valuation by 2032—growing at a robust CAGR of 9.2% from a 2025 base of US$2.36 billion—the convergence of mobile penetration, open banking APIs, and climate-smart agriculture is creating a fertile ground for scalable, tech-enabled financial inclusion.

Exclusive Industry Perspective: Divergent Approaches in Dispersed Farming vs. Commercial Agriculture
A critical distinction is emerging between platforms serving fragmented smallholder ecosystems and those targeting consolidated commercial agriculture operations. In dispersed smallholder markets, platforms prioritize digital lending models that utilize psychometric assessments and social capital metrics to underwrite borrowers with no formal credit history. User acquisition often occurs through agent networks and farmer cooperative structures, with loan sizes typically under US$500. In contrast, platforms focused on commercial agriculture emphasize supply chain integration, offering inventory financing and receivables discounting to medium-scale producers. These platforms increasingly deploy IoT-enabled collateral monitoring, using sensors on farm equipment or storage facilities to manage default risk in real time.

Technological Infrastructure and Data Integration Challenges
One of the persistent technical hurdles in scaling Agri-Fintech Platforms is the interoperability gap between disparate agricultural data sources. While platforms have made strides in utilizing satellite-derived vegetation indices for crop health monitoring, integration with government land registries and cooperative databases remains fragmented. Over the past quarter, several national governments—including Kenya and India—have accelerated efforts to implement unified agricultural stack frameworks (modeled after India’s AgriStack) that standardize farmer identity, land records, and transaction histories. These policy developments are expected to significantly reduce integration costs and enable more robust alternative credit scoring models for platform operators.

Regulatory Tailwinds and Risk Management Evolution
Regulatory support for agricultural fintech has intensified, with central banks in key emerging markets issuing tailored licensing frameworks for non-bank financial entities serving agriculture. Concurrently, the insurance component of the market is witnessing innovation in parametric products, where payouts are automatically triggered by weather station data rather than traditional loss assessment. This shift reduces administrative overhead and improves claim settlement speed, directly addressing a historic pain point for smallholder policyholders.

Core Market Segmentation and Application Analysis
As a broad-spectrum antimicrobial, Sulfachloropyridazine Sodium operates by competitively inhibiting the bacterial enzyme dihydrofolate synthetase, thereby disrupting folic acid synthesis—a mechanism that remains critical for controlling common pathogens such as E. coliSalmonella, and Pasteurella. Its sodium salt formulation significantly enhances solubility, making it a preferred choice for both oral solutions and parenteral injectable formulations in veterinary practice.

The market is meticulously segmented to provide a granular view of industry supply and demand:

  • By Type (Purity Levels): The market bifurcates into products with purity levels of ≥98% and ≥99%. The ≥99% purity segment is gaining traction among large-scale pharmaceutical manufacturers focused on high-efficacy formulations and reduced impurity profiles, aligning with stricter pharmacopoeial standards (such as USP and EP) implemented in key export markets.
  • By Application (End-Use Species): The primary application segments are Pigs, Poultry, and Others (including ruminants and aquaculture). The poultry segment currently holds a dominant share due to the high density of broiler and layer operations and the persistent need for managing colibacillosis and fowl cholera. Meanwhile, the swine segment is witnessing evolving usage patterns as producers adopt more targeted metaphylaxis strategies to comply with antibiotic stewardship programs initiated by regulatory bodies like the EMA and FDA in recent quarters.

1. Market Definition and the Shift to Precision Aquaculture

An IoT-based aquaculture system is a smart farming solution that integrates Internet of Things technologies to monitor and manage aquatic farming environments in real time. It uses connected sensors and devices to collect data on key parameters such as water temperature, pH, dissolved oxygen, turbidity, ammonia levels, and fish activity. This data is transmitted to cloud-based platforms or local control systems, enabling automated adjustments—such as aeration, feeding, and water exchange—and providing early warnings of harmful conditions. The system improves productivity, reduces manual labor, and enhances sustainability and disease prevention in fish, shrimp, or shellfish farming operations. This transition from manual spot-checking to continuous, automated oversight represents the core of modern precision aquaculture.

3. Technology Deployment: Real-Time Water Quality Monitoring as the Core Application

Across all application segments, real-time water quality monitoring remains the most critical use case. Dissolved oxygen sensors alone account for approximately 35% of sensor deployments, given their direct correlation with fish health and mortality risk. In shrimp farming, ammonia and pH monitoring are equally prioritized, as fluctuations can trigger mass mortality within 24–48 hours.

A notable case study involves a large-scale shrimp farm in Thailand that deployed an integrated IoT system across 120 ponds. By implementing automated aeration triggered by dissolved oxygen thresholds, the farm reduced daily mortality by 22% and cut energy costs by 18% compared to fixed-schedule aeration. The system also enabled early detection of vibrio bacteria proliferation through temperature-ammonia correlation alerts, preventing a potential outbreak that historically caused 30% crop loss.

4. Regulatory Tailwinds and Sustainability Drivers

Regulatory frameworks are increasingly favoring IoT adoption in aquaculture. The European Union’s revised aquaculture guidelines now require enhanced environmental monitoring for licensed operations, with digital reporting becoming a compliance standard. In Norway, the world’s largest salmon producer, new regulations mandate real-time reporting of sea lice levels and mortality events, driving rapid adoption of sensor networks and cloud-based compliance platforms.

Sustainability certifications such as the Aquaculture Stewardship Council (ASC) and Best Aquaculture Practices (BAP) are also incorporating digital monitoring requirements, creating market access incentives for producers to adopt IoT systems. This regulatory pressure is particularly pronounced in export-oriented markets, where traceability and environmental impact documentation are increasingly non-negotiable.

6. Exclusive Observation: The Convergence of AI and Edge Computing

An emerging development warranting attention is the convergence of AI-driven predictive analytics with edge computing capabilities. While early IoT deployments relied on cloud-based processing, latency-sensitive applications—such as automatic mortality detection via underwater cameras or real-time feeding optimization—are increasingly moving to edge devices. This shift reduces bandwidth costs and enables autonomous decision-making even in remote farming locations with limited connectivity.

Additionally, the integration of computer vision with traditional sensor data is creating new possibilities for non-invasive biomass estimation and early disease detection. For example, several suppliers now offer AI models that analyze fish feeding behavior to detect appetite changes days before conventional metrics would indicate health issues.

1. Market Definition and Strategic Importance of Growing Benches

Greenhouse Growing Benches are raised platforms designed to support plant cultivation by providing an organized, elevated growing surface. These structures enhance air circulation, optimize drainage, and improve accessibility, all of which are essential for creating controlled microclimates. Beyond basic functionality, modern benches are engineered to integrate with irrigation systems, climate sensors, and automated material handling—transforming them from passive equipment into active components of precision horticulture.

2. Industry Segmentation: Discrete Manufacturing vs. Process-Driven Cultivation

A nuanced analysis of the market reveals a critical distinction between discrete manufacturing-style bench production and process-driven cultivation systems. Discrete manufacturing focuses on standardized, modular bench components suited for large-scale flower and vegetable growers with predictable layouts. In contrast, process-driven applications—such as cannabis cultivation and high-density berry production—require fully integrated systems that align with automated harvesting, fertigation, and robotic transplanting.

In the past six months, demand for mobile bench systems has accelerated in North America and Europe, driven by cannabis producers seeking to maximize legal cultivation licenses. For example, a licensed cannabis operator in California recently replaced fixed benches with mobile systems, increasing usable growing space by 28% while reducing manual labor hours by 18% through integrated cart movement and automated irrigation.

Defining the Digital Brain of High-Tech Manufacturing

An Electronics/Semiconductor Manufacturing Execution System (MES) is a specialized software platform designed to manage, monitor, and optimize the entire production lifecycle of electronic components (such as printed circuit boards, capacitors, resistors) and semiconductor devices (including integrated circuits, microchips, diodes). Unlike general-purpose MES solutions, this category is engineered to address the unique complexities of electronics and semiconductor manufacturing:

  • High-Precision Process Control: Manages processes with tolerances measured in nanometers, requiring real-time monitoring and adjustment.
  • Strict Traceability: Maintains full genealogy from raw wafers or components to finished products, essential for quality assurance, failure analysis, and regulatory compliance.
  • Cleanroom Environment Monitoring: Integrates with environmental sensors to track and control particle counts, temperature, and humidity critical for yield.
  • Equipment Integration: Connects seamlessly with specialized production equipment, including lithography machines, etching tools, deposition systems, and testing equipment, to collect real-time data and control operations.
  • Yield Management and Defect Analysis: Tracks yield at each process step, analyzes defect patterns, and enables root cause identification to drive continuous improvement.
  • Compliance with Industry Standards: Ensures adherence to standards such as ISO 9001 for quality, IPC standards for electronics assembly, and automotive quality standards (e.g., IATF 16949) for semiconductor components.

Core functions of a semiconductor MES include:

  • Real-Time Production Scheduling: Optimizing work-in-progress (WIP) flow through complex, multi-step processes.
  • Process Parameter Tracking: Recording and analyzing critical parameters (temperature, pressure, time) for each process step.
  • Material Management: Tracking lots, wafers, and components throughout the production cycle.
  • Equipment Maintenance Management: Scheduling and tracking preventive maintenance to minimize downtime.
  • Data Integration: Connecting upstream to ERP (Enterprise Resource Planning) systems for planning and downstream to SPC (Statistical Process Control) tools for quality analysis.

The market is segmented by Type based on deployment model, a key factor for security, scalability, and IT infrastructure requirements:

  • On-Premises: The traditional model, where the MES software is installed and managed on the manufacturer’s own servers. This offers maximum control over data security and customization but requires significant IT infrastructure and capital investment.
  • On-Demand (Cloud/SaaS): A rapidly growing segment. The MES is delivered as a cloud-based subscription service, offering faster deployment, lower upfront costs, automatic updates, and scalability. This model is particularly attractive to small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) and for specific use cases.
  • Hybrid: Combines on-premises and cloud components, allowing manufacturers to keep sensitive data on-site while leveraging cloud capabilities for analytics, collaboration, or less critical functions.

These systems are used by organizations of all sizes, segmented by Application:

  • Large Enterprises: Major semiconductor fabs (foundries, IDMs) and large electronics assembly plants. These organizations require highly customized, scalable MES solutions capable of managing massive production volumes and complex, multi-facility operations.
  • Small and Medium-Sized Enterprises (SMEs): Specialized chip design firms, fabless semiconductor companies (outsourcing manufacturing), and smaller electronics manufacturers. They often prefer cloud-based or more modular MES solutions that offer core functionality without the complexity of large-scale enterprise systems.

The upstream supply chain involves software developers, system integrators, and hardware providers (servers, networking). Midstream, the market is served by specialized MES vendors and large industrial automation and IT companies. Downstream, customers are semiconductor fabs, electronics assembly plants, and other high-tech manufacturers.

Defining the Essential Support for Data Privacy Compliance

A Subject Access Request (SAR) consultancy service is a professional advisory and support offering that helps organizations manage, respond to, and comply with requests from individuals seeking access to their personal data under data protection and privacy laws. These services are critical for organizations facing the operational and legal challenges of fulfilling these requests within mandated timeframes (typically 30 days under GDPR) while ensuring data accuracy, security, and legal compliance.

The market is segmented by Type into two primary categories, reflecting the dual nature of the solution:

  • Automation Software Platform: Specialized technology platforms that automate the end-to-end SAR fulfillment process. Key features include:
    • Request Intake: Centralized portals for receiving and tracking requests.
    • Identity Verification: Tools to verify the identity of requestors to prevent unauthorized access.
    • Data Discovery and Inventory: Scanning of enterprise systems to locate personal data relevant to the request.
    • Redaction and Review: Automated tools to identify and redact exempt information (e.g., third-party data, legally privileged information).
    • Workflow Management: Automated routing of requests for review and approval.
    • Reporting and Audit Trails: Comprehensive documentation for compliance reporting.
    • Integration: APIs to connect with existing HR, CRM, and other data systems.
  • Professional Consulting Services: Expert advisory services that guide organizations through the SAR process. These include:
    • Strategy and Governance: Developing SAR policies, procedures, and governance frameworks.
    • Legal Interpretation: Advising on the application of complex legal exemptions and obligations.
    • Process Optimization: Streamlining SAR workflows for efficiency and consistency.
    • Training and Education: Preparing internal teams to handle SARs appropriately.
    • Outsourced Fulfillment: End-to-end management of SARs on behalf of the organization.
    • Audit and Compliance Review: Assessing SAR processes for regulatory compliance.
  • Other Services: Includes hybrid offerings combining software and consulting, as well as specialized services for specific industries or jurisdictions.

These services are critical across industries that handle large volumes of personal data, segmented by Application:

  • Financial Industry: Banks, insurers, and investment firms face a high volume of SARs from customers and must ensure secure handling of sensitive financial data.
  • Healthcare Industry: Hospitals, insurers, and pharmaceutical companies must manage SARs for patient records while navigating complex health privacy regulations (e.g., HIPAA in the US).
  • Technology and Internet: Tech companies and online platforms handle vast amounts of user data and face high volumes of SARs, often from global user bases.
  • Other Applications: Includes retail, telecommunications, manufacturing, and public sector organizations.

The customer base includes multinational corporations, mid-sized enterprises, and organizations in highly regulated industries. Key buyers are Chief Privacy Officers, Chief Compliance Officers, Chief Information Security Officers, and legal departments.

Defining the Evolution of Inhaled Respiratory Therapy

Combination medications for inhaled treatments represent a significant advancement in the management of chronic respiratory diseases. These fixed-dose combination (FDC) products deliver two or more active pharmaceutical ingredients in a single inhaler device, simplifying the treatment regimen and reducing the number of separate inhalers a patient must manage. This approach has been shown to improve adherence, a critical factor in achieving optimal clinical outcomes.

The market is segmented by Type based on the combination of therapeutic classes, each targeting different aspects of disease pathophysiology:

  • ICS/LABA (Inhaled Corticosteroid / Long-Acting Beta-Agonist): The cornerstone of asthma management and widely used in COPD. ICS reduce airway inflammation, while LABA provides sustained bronchodilation. This combination addresses both the underlying inflammation and the symptom of airway constriction. It is the standard of care for patients requiring step-up therapy in asthma. Examples include fluticasone/salmeterol (Advair/Seretide) and budesonide/formoterol (Symbicort).
  • LABA/LAMA (Long-Acting Beta-Agonist / Long-Acting Muscarinic Antagonist): A dual bronchodilator combination used primarily in COPD. LABA and LAMA work through complementary mechanisms to relax airway smooth muscle and reduce airflow obstruction. This combination offers superior bronchodilation compared to either agent alone and is a key maintenance therapy for COPD. Examples include indacaterol/glycopyrronium (Ultibro) and umeclidinium/vilanterol (Anoro Ellipta).
  • ICS/LABA/LAMA (Triple Therapy): The newest and most comprehensive class, combining an inhaled corticosteroid with two long-acting bronchodilators (LABA and LAMA) in a single inhaler. This triple combination addresses both inflammation and bronchodilation, offering a simplified option for patients with moderate-to-severe COPD or asthma who require multiple controller therapies. Examples include fluticasone furoate/umeclidinium/vilanterol (Trelegy Ellipta) and beclomethasone/formoterol/glycopyrronium (Trimbow).
  • Other Combinations: Includes dual short-acting bronchodilator combinations (e.g., albuterol/ipratropium, Combivent) used primarily for rapid relief in COPD, and other emerging combinations.

These combination products are available in various inhaler device formats, including pressurized metered-dose inhalers (pMDIs), dry powder inhalers (DPIs), and soft mist inhalers (SMIs), each with specific handling characteristics and patient preferences.

These medications are prescribed for the management of:

  • Asthma: ICS/LABA combinations are the mainstay of maintenance therapy for patients with persistent asthma. Triple therapy is used in severe asthma.
  • COPD: LABA/LAMA combinations are first-line maintenance therapy for many patients. ICS/LABA is used in patients with frequent exacerbations and elevated eosinophils. Triple therapy is used for patients with more severe disease or persistent symptoms despite dual therapy.
  • Other: Includes bronchiectasis and other chronic airway conditions.

The upstream supply chain involves manufacturers of the active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) for each drug class, as well as specialized inhaler device manufacturers. Midstream, global pharmaceutical companies formulate, manufacture, and market these branded combination products. Downstream, the products are prescribed by pulmonologists, primary care physicians, and other healthcare providers, and dispensed through retail and hospital pharmacies.

1. The Shift from Separate Inhalers to Fixed-Dose Combinations
The primary driver for this market is the clinical and practical superiority of fixed-dose combinations over separate inhalers. FDCs simplify treatment regimens, reduce “pill burden” (inhaler burden), and improve adherence. Studies consistently show that patients using combination inhalers have better adherence and outcomes than those using separate devices. This has made FDCs the standard of care across asthma and COPD treatment guidelines.

2. The Evolution from Dual to Triple Therapy
A defining trend is the emergence and rapid adoption of single-inhaler triple therapy (ICS/LABA/LAMA) for moderate-to-severe COPD and severe asthma. Triple therapy offers the most comprehensive pharmacological approach, addressing both inflammation and bronchodilation in a single device. Clinical trials have demonstrated superior outcomes compared to dual therapy, and this class is capturing an increasing share of the market, particularly for patients with frequent exacerbations.

3. The Dominance of the ICS/LABA Class in Asthma
For asthma, ICS/LABA combinations remain the dominant class for patients requiring step-up therapy. Their established efficacy, safety profile, and long history of use have made them the benchmark against which new therapies are measured. While triple therapy is emerging for severe asthma, ICS/LABA remains the foundation for the majority of persistent asthma patients.

4. The LABA/LAMA Class as First-Line COPD Therapy
Treatment guidelines (GOLD) recommend LABA/LAMA as first-line maintenance therapy for most COPD patients. This dual bronchodilator approach offers superior symptom relief and exacerbation reduction compared to monotherapy. The widespread adoption of LABA/LAMA combinations has made them a significant and growing segment of the combination inhaler market.

5. The Impact of Patent Expirations and Generic Entry
The market has experienced significant patent expirations on key ICS/LABA and LABA/LAMA products, leading to the entry of generic and authorized generic versions. This has increased patient access and reduced costs but has also pressured pricing and margins for branded products. However, the shift toward newer once-daily combinations and triple therapy has created new, protected market opportunities.

Defining the Cornerstone of Long-Term Airway Management

Long-acting beta-agonists (LABAs) are a class of inhaled bronchodilators that form the foundation of maintenance therapy for asthma and COPD. Unlike short-acting beta-agonists (SABAs), which are used for rapid relief of acute symptoms, LABAs are designed for regular, daily use to provide sustained, prolonged bronchodilation, typically lasting 12 hours or more. Their mechanism of action involves continuous stimulation of β2-adrenergic receptors in the airway smooth muscle, leading to sustained relaxation and opening of the airways.

The key characteristics of LABAs include:

  • Extended Duration of Action: Provide 12-24 hours of bronchodilation, enabling twice-daily or once-daily dosing.
  • Symptom Control: Reduce daytime and nighttime symptoms, improving sleep quality and daily functioning.
  • Exacerbation Prevention: Reduce the frequency of acute exacerbations when used as part of a regular maintenance regimen.
  • Improved Lung Function: Consistently improve spirometric measures such as forced expiratory volume in one second (FEV1).
  • Quality of Life Enhancement: Allow patients to engage in daily activities with fewer respiratory limitations.

The market is segmented by Type based on the specific LABA molecule, each with distinct pharmacokinetic profiles, dosing schedules, and clinical positioning:

  • Salmeterol: One of the first widely used LABAs. It has a relatively slower onset of action and is typically dosed twice daily. Often used in combination with inhaled corticosteroids (ICS) in fixed-dose combination inhalers for asthma.
  • Formoterol: Characterized by a rapid onset of action (similar to a SABA) combined with a long duration (12 hours). This unique profile allows it to be used for both maintenance and as-needed relief in some treatment regimens. It is a key component of ICS/formoterol combination therapies.
  • Indacaterol: A once-daily LABA developed primarily for COPD. Its ultra-long duration of action (24 hours) simplifies dosing and improves adherence.
  • Olodaterol: Another once-daily LABA, also indicated primarily for COPD, offering 24-hour bronchodilation with a favorable safety profile.
  • Other LABAs: Includes newer or less widely used agents, and combination products.

These medications are prescribed across various healthcare settings, segmented by Application:

  • Hospitals: Used for inpatient management of acute exacerbations and initiation of maintenance therapy.
  • Clinics (Outpatient): The primary setting for long-term prescription and management of asthma and COPD.
  • Other: Includes community health centers and home care settings.

LABAs are almost always used as part of a comprehensive treatment regimen. For asthma, they are prescribed in combination with inhaled corticosteroids (ICS) as fixed-dose combinations (e.g., ICS/LABA). For COPD, they are used alone or in combination with long-acting muscarinic antagonists (LAMAs) and/or ICS. The global treatment guidelines (GINA for asthma, GOLD for COPD) provide the framework for LABA use.

The upstream supply chain involves manufacturers of the active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) for each LABA molecule, as well as inhalation device manufacturers (dry powder inhalers, metered-dose inhalers). Midstream, global pharmaceutical companies formulate, manufacture, and market branded and generic LABA products. Downstream, the products are prescribed by pulmonologists, primary care physicians, and other healthcare providers, and dispensed through retail pharmacies, hospital pharmacies, and mail-order pharmacies.

Defining the Essential Tools of Global Logistics

Wooden pallets and containers represent the foundational layer of the global supply chain. They are transport and storage platforms and enclosures primarily constructed from natural wood (such as pine, oak, or hardwood) or processed wood-based panels (like plywood or oriented strand board). Their core function is to provide a stable, durable base or enclosure that protects goods during handling, stacking, and transportation.

The market is segmented by Type into two primary categories:

  • Pallets: Flat, portable platforms used to stack, store, and move goods. Pallets allow for efficient handling by forklifts, pallet jacks, and other material handling equipment. They are the most common form of unit load base, enabling efficient storage and transport. Key characteristics include:
    • Stringer Pallets: The most common design, with parallel runners (stringers) supporting deck boards.
    • Block Pallets: Feature blocks between deck boards, allowing for four-way entry by forklifts.
    • Custom Designs: Tailored to specific product dimensions or load requirements.
  • Containers: Enclosed or partially enclosed wooden structures used to protect goods during transport. These can range from simple crates to more complex, custom-built enclosures. Containers offer enhanced protection from impact, stacking pressure, and environmental elements. Key types include:
    • Wooden Crates: Enclosed boxes used for shipping heavy or fragile items.
    • Wirebound Containers: Lightweight, collapsible containers made from wood slats and wire, often used for produce or light industrial goods.
    • Reusable Containers: Durable containers designed for multiple trips, often used in closed-loop supply chains.

These packaging solutions are critical across a vast range of industries, segmented by Application:

  • Food and Beverage: Pallets and containers are used to transport raw ingredients, packaged goods, and beverages. They must meet hygiene standards and may require specific treatments (e.g., heat treatment) for international shipping.
  • Machinery: Heavy machinery, industrial equipment, and automotive parts rely on the high load-bearing capacity and impact resistance of wooden pallets and crates.
  • Electronics and Appliances: Sensitive electronics and appliances require the protective cushioning and structural integrity of wooden containers to prevent damage during transit.
  • Automotive: The automotive industry is a major user of both pallets and reusable containers for transporting components, assemblies, and finished vehicles.
  • Other Applications: Includes chemicals, pharmaceuticals, construction materials, and countless other industrial and consumer goods.

The upstream supply chain involves forestry and lumber producers, plywood and engineered wood manufacturers, and suppliers of fasteners (nails, staples). Midstream, pallet and container manufacturers fabricate standard and custom products. Downstream, customers span virtually every industry sector, from manufacturing and agriculture to retail and logistics.

2. The ISPM 15 Regulatory Framework
The International Standards for Phytosanitary Measures No. 15 (ISPM 15) is the most significant regulatory force in the market. It mandates that all wood packaging material used in international trade must be treated (heat treatment or fumigation) and marked to prevent the spread of invasive pests. This has standardized the industry and driven a global shift toward heat-treated wood. Compliance is non-negotiable for export shipments, making certified pallet and container suppliers essential partners for exporters.

3. The Rise of Sustainable and Circular Packaging
While wood is inherently renewable and biodegradable, there is a growing focus on sustainability in the packaging industry. Key trends include:

  • Reusable Pallets and Containers: Closed-loop systems where pallets are designed for multiple trips, reducing waste and lowering total cost of ownership.
  • Repair and Recycling Programs: Extending the life of pallets through repair services and recycling damaged units into new products.
  • Certified Sustainable Wood: Increasing use of FSC-certified lumber to meet corporate sustainability goals.
  • Engineered Wood Products: Utilizing plywood and OSB to maximize yield from timber resources.

4. The Demand for Customization and Engineering Solutions
Industrial goods come in infinite varieties of shapes, weights, and fragility levels. Off-the-shelf pallets and containers are often inadequate. This drives significant demand for custom-engineered packaging designed to meet specific load requirements, protect delicate components, and optimize shipping container space. Pallet and container manufacturers differentiate themselves through design expertise, engineering capabilities, and the ability to provide “packaged-to-ship” solutions.

5. The Shift Toward Automation and Standardization
The increasing automation of warehouses and distribution centers is driving demand for pallets with consistent dimensions and high-quality construction. Automated storage and retrieval systems (AS/RS), robotic palletizers, and automated guided vehicles (AGVs) require pallets that are dimensionally precise, have consistent deck spacing, and are free from defects that could cause jams or equipment damage. This is pushing the market toward higher-quality, standardized pallet designs.

Defining the Intelligent Sentinel of the Cold Chain

A low-temperature smart cold chain tracker is an intelligent monitoring device designed to ensure the safety, quality, and compliance of temperature-sensitive goods throughout the logistics process. These devices are deployed within shipments to provide continuous, real-time tracking of critical parameters, primarily temperature, but increasingly including humidity, shock/vibration, light exposure, and location.

The market is segmented by Type based on the functionality and intended use:

  • Temperature Data Loggers: The foundational segment. These devices record temperature at programmed intervals, storing data for download upon arrival. They are essential for verifying temperature compliance throughout a shipment’s journey. Modern versions offer Bluetooth or NFC for easy data retrieval via smartphone.
  • Location-Based Trackers: These devices leverage GPS, cellular, or satellite networks to provide real-time location visibility. They are critical for tracking high-value shipments, identifying delays, and managing inventory in transit.
  • Multi-Parameter Smart Trackers: The fastest-growing segment. These advanced devices combine temperature, humidity, location, shock, and light sensing in a single unit. They transmit data in real-time via cellular or satellite networks, enabling proactive intervention if parameters deviate from set thresholds. They often integrate with cloud platforms for fleet-wide visibility and analytics.
  • Single-Use Trackers: Disposable, pre-programmed trackers designed for a single shipment. They are cost-effective for less frequent shipments and eliminate the need for return logistics. They are widely used in pharmaceutical and biologics distribution.
  • Other Trackers: Includes specialized devices for ultra-low temperature applications (e.g., cryogenic storage) and RFID-based tracking solutions.

These trackers are deployed across critical Applications:

  • Pharmaceutical Cold Chain: The largest and most demanding segment. Includes vaccines, biologics, insulin, and other temperature-sensitive drugs that must be maintained within strict temperature ranges (often 2-8°C, or -20°C, -80°C for some biologics) from manufacturing to patient administration. Regulatory requirements (e.g., GDP, FDA 21 CFR Part 11) mandate rigorous temperature monitoring.
  • Food Cold Chain: A vast segment encompassing fresh produce, dairy, meat, seafood, and frozen foods. Trackers ensure food safety, reduce spoilage, and extend shelf life.
  • Biological Sample Transportation: Transport of blood, tissue, and other biological specimens for testing and research. These samples often require strict temperature control and chain-of-custody documentation.
  • Chemical Goods Transportation: Monitoring of temperature-sensitive chemicals and reagents used in manufacturing and research.
  • Other Applications: Includes transport of floral products, fine art, and other temperature-sensitive goods.

The upstream supply chain involves manufacturers of sensors (temperature, humidity, GPS), wireless communication modules (cellular, Bluetooth, LoRa), batteries, and printed circuit boards. Midstream, device manufacturers integrate these components into ruggedized, often single-use or reusable, trackers. Downstream, logistics providers, pharmaceutical companies, food distributors, and healthcare organizations deploy these devices.
